Scope

1.1 These test methods cover testing synthetic dielectric fluids currently in use for capacitors. The methods are generally suitable for specification acceptance, factory control, referee testing, and research. Their applicability to future fluids has not been determined.

1.2 The scope of some of the test methods listed here apply to petroleum oils, but have been found suitable for synthetic fluids.

1.3 For methods relating to polybutene fluids refer to Specification D2296.

1.4 For methods relating to silicone fluids refer to Test Methods D2225.

1.5 A list of properties and standards are as follows:

Property MeasuredSectionASTM Test Method
Physical:
Coefficient of thermal expansion6D 1903
Flash point7D 92
Pour point8D 97
Refractive index9 D 1218
Relative Density/Specific gravity10 D 1298
Viscosity11D 445
Chemical:
Acid number12D 664
Water content13D 1533
Electrical:
Relative permittivity14 D 924
Dielectric strength15D 877
D 1816
Dissipation factor16D 924
